TI中文支持网
TI专业的中文技术问题搜集分享网站

FOC矢量控制中CLARKE出现的问题

运用28335 FOC进行矢量控制

目前电流A B相已经测量正确,相差120'

将AB相电流送入CLARKE变换,得到输出不正确

左为Alpha 右Beta

得到并不是相差90‘的正玄波’

rookiecalf:

你用的CLARKE变换是哪的,输入有没有什么特殊要求(如做标幺化处理等)

运用28335 FOC进行矢量控制

目前电流A B相已经测量正确,相差120'

将AB相电流送入CLARKE变换,得到输出不正确

左为Alpha 右Beta

得到并不是相差90‘的正玄波’

BigXing:

回复 rookiecalf:

试用的clarke是ti dmc里面的

电流经过kcurrent定标和Q格式转换,

无论用Q几格式,算出来的都是这样,没有明显的正弦

运用28335 FOC进行矢量控制

目前电流A B相已经测量正确,相差120'

将AB相电流送入CLARKE变换,得到输出不正确

左为Alpha 右Beta

得到并不是相差90‘的正玄波’

rookiecalf:

回复 BigXing:

找两个固定值带进去看一下beta运算的结果对不对,看看是不是IQmath用的有问题

运用28335 FOC进行矢量控制

目前电流A B相已经测量正确,相差120'

将AB相电流送入CLARKE变换,得到输出不正确

左为Alpha 右Beta

得到并不是相差90‘的正玄波’

BigXing:

回复 rookiecalf:

自己写了个相差120‘的正弦进去,结果正确的

已经弄了几天 了,不知道什么问题

赞(0)
未经允许不得转载:TI中文支持网 » FOC矢量控制中CLARKE出现的问题
分享到: 更多 (0)